Runbook fragment — Resharding the Ostermere profile store. Before splitting shard P3, freeze writes via the admin toggle and verify replication lag is under 2s on both replicas. Run the split planner in dry-run mode first; it emits the proposed key ranges. If the planner aborts, do not retry more than twice — escalate instead. Record the planner's output and attach the identifier printed at completion, shown below.

pipeline stamp: htk9_ce63042d9

### Rendering Performance

Heads up: Glyphbox compiles templates once and caches them per tenant, so your plugin shouldn't re-render on every request. If you're seeing slow renders, it's almost always an uncached partial. Profile with the internal Rendertrace service to confirm. To call Rendertrace from your plugin's sandbox, authenticate with the key below.

app token of bahaf-tajeg = zpat23_SjjsllwiLmXbtS65veZaV47

Minutes — Management Meeting, Lease Renegotiation

Present: J. Calder, M. Rusova, P. Enwright. The lease on the Dorvale Street premises was renegotiated to a five-year term with a stepped rent reduction of 8%. Fit-out costs fall to the landlord. Sales leads should note reduced occupancy charges from April. Rationale follows in the confidential note below.

internal memo for kaguf-yajog: Headcount on the Druath team goes from 30 to 70 by the end of November. Gross margin on Druath came in at 56 percent against a plan of 28 percent.

Test-plan note — Striderbeam chip reader, v4.2 regression

Before we sign off for the Millbrae Harbor Marathon sim, we need the split-mat readers rechecked under burst load — last round, the Gate 3 unit dropped reads when 40+ chips crossed inside two seconds. Run the replay harness with the recorded Finchford race data and confirm zero dropped tags at 2x speed. The replay harness posts results to the timing staging API, which authenticates with the bearer token below.

login token, yajef-fadup: eyJhbGciOiJIUzI1NiIsInR5cCI6IkpXVCJ9.eyJzdWIiOiI315NbSnGsvIn0.MeCu-AV7V_Xh